We are seeking a reliable and customer-focused Desktop Support Technician to provide technical support for end users in a fast-paced hospital environment. This role is essential in ensuring the smooth operation of clinical and administrative systems, supporting both patient care and hospital operations.
Key Responsibilities:
- Provide on-site and remote technical support for desktops, laptops, printers, mobile devices, and other end-user hardware.
- Install, configure, and troubleshoot Windows OS, Microsoft Office, and hospital-specific applications (e.g., EHR/EMR systems like Epic, Cerner).
- Respond to service requests and incidents via the hospital's ticketing system, ensuring timely resolution and documentation.
- Support clinical staff with workstation and device issues in patient care areas, including nurses' stations, exam rooms, and labs.
- Maintain and update asset inventory records for all IT equipment.
- Assist with hardware deployments, upgrades, and relocations.
- Ensure compliance with HIPAA and hospital IT security policies.
- Collaborate with network, server, and application teams to escalate and resolve complex issues.
- Participate in on-call rotation and provide after-hours support as needed.
Qualifications:
- Associate degree in Information Technology or related field; or equivalent work experience.
- 2+ years of desktop support experience, preferably in a healthcare or hospital setting.
- Strong knowledge of Windows OS, Active Directory, and Microsoft Office Suite.
- Familiarity with EHR/EMR systems and clinical workflows is a plus.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with a customer-first mindset.
- Ability to work in a clinical environment, including patient care areas.
- Must be able to lift and move equipment (up to 50 lbs) and travel between hospital departments or satellite locations.
Preferred Certifications:
- CompTIA A+, Network+, or equivalent
- Microsoft Certified: Modern Desktop Administrator Associate
- ITIL Foundation (a plus)
